According to the show’s creative team, Dexter: Resurrection is all set to return with its second season on Paramount+ in October 2026. After months of speculation, the deadline has finally been decided.
Filming is scheduled to begin in spring 2026, putting the series on a steady schedule from year to year.
What to Expect from Dexter: Resurrection Season 2?
Showrunner Clyde Phillips confirmed that cameras on the Love It Film Podcast will begin rolling on April 13, 2026. Shooting will take place in New York City, the same setting that was used for the majority of Season 1.
As Screen Rant reports, the second season will run for 10 episodes, matching the structure of the previous installment. Post-production is expected to last through the summer, in line with an October 2026 release window.
Michael C. Hall returns as Dexter Morgan. He is also attached as an executive producer and is continuing his expanded role in shaping the direction of the series.

Season 1 ended without any conclusion. Dexter survived, his identity intact, and the consequences remained unsolved. That ending was intentional.
According to those involved, the goal was never to have a closed loop. According to Red94, season 2 is expected to pick up directly from those loose threads – personal risks, unfulfilled relationships, and the question of how long Dexter can remain hidden.
The returning cast includes Jack Alcott and James Remar as well as several familiar faces from the first season. Their arcs, intentionally left open, are expected to deepen rather than reset.

Director Marcos Siega is once again involved, maintaining visual continuity. The production timeline mirrors Season 1, although the writers have hinted at a broader narrative base this time.
There is no indication of a short run or experimental format. It is a continuation, not a reinvention.

Between now and release, there is a long period of peace. No teaser date has been announced. No episode title or opening footage has been released.
The series remains Paramount+’s primary investment in the Dexter universe after the prequel project – Dexter: Original Sin – was canceled in early August, Variety reports. Internally, there has been a focus on stability with fewer spin-offs and tighter storytelling.
At present the path is clear. Dexter Morgan will return again in October 2026. Filming is expected to begin in early 2026, followed by post-production by summer.
